But, if you are using Windows XP, then go to C:\Windows\System32\MarineAquarium3.scr Right click on the MarineAquarium3.scr and choose create shortcut. When it shows up at the bottom of your list, drag it and only it off onto your desktop. :) Be aware that the files you are delving into are your windows operating files, DO NOT mess with any others or problems with windows itself could ensue. |
Or select the "Send To" tab and place it directly on your desktop

Your settings files should be in: C:\Users\Your Personal Account Name\AppData\Roaming\Marine Aquarium 3 Are you perhaps now using a different account (User Name) on the computer? If so, that explains how you "lost" the settings and icon. The settings in MA3 are "per user" - of course. |
